Twitter Rolling Out Advert Income Sharing For Blue Subscribers

Whereas the large payout figures will undoubtedly seize eyeballs, the vast majority of Twitter customers will be unable to make the most of this revenue-sharing mannequin. To start with, customers wishing to be a part of this system can be required to pay for Twitter’s Blue subscription. That, nevertheless, is not the only eligibility standards.
Even with a Twitter Blue subscription, customers are anticipated to hit 5 million or extra Tweet impressions consecutively for the previous three months to be eligible. This requirement filters a big chunk of Twitter Blue subscribers from collaborating in this system. As well as, the income sharing program — in its present kind — is barely open to U.S. creators, which leaves out numerous customers from different markets from collaborating.
